Kuchila

Kuchila is a village located in Balurghat subdivision of Dakshin Dinajpur district in West Bengal, India. It is situated 13.7km away from Balurghat, which is both district & sub-district headquarter of Kuchila village. As per 2009 stats, Gopalbati is the gram panchayat of Kuchila village.

About Kuchila

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Kuchila is 311290. The village spans a total geographical area of 155.55 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 733145. Balurghat is nearest town to Kuchila village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 10km away.

When it comes to local governance, Kuchila village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Tapan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Balurghat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Kuchila

Below is a concise population overview of Kuchila as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 864 460 404
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 69 35 34
Scheduled Castes (SC) 226 124 102
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 150 75 75
Literate Population 629 358 271
Illiterate Population 235 102 133

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Kuchila village:

  • The total population of Kuchila village is around 864, including approximately 460 males and 404 females, with a sex ratio of 878 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 69 children aged 0–6 years in Kuchila village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• Kuchila village has 226 people belonging to the Scheduled Castes (SC) and 150 residents from the Scheduled Tribes (ST).
  • The literacy rate of Kuchila village is about 72.80%, with male literacy at 77.83% and female literacy at 67.08%.
  • There are around 193 households in Kuchila village.

Connectivity of Kuchila

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Kuchila. As per the 2011 stats, Kuchila had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Private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
